BMS Integration for HVAC refers to the integration of Building Management Systems (BMS) with Heating, Ventilation, and Air Conditioning (HVAC) systems. This integration allows for centralized control and monitoring of HVAC equipment, enhancing energy efficiency and operational performance. BMS systems collect data from various sensors and devices, enabling real-time adjustments to HVAC functions based on occupancy, environmental conditions, and energy usage.
The primary uses of BMS Integration for HVAC include optimizing energy consumption, maintaining indoor air quality, and ensuring occupant comfort. Businesses can leverage this technology to automate HVAC operations, resulting in reduced energy costs and improved system reliability. The integration is particularly beneficial in large commercial buildings, industrial facilities, and multi-tenant properties, where efficient HVAC management is crucial for both operational effectiveness and regulatory compliance.

๐๐ฒ๐ ๐๐ฒ๐ฎ๐๐๐ฟ๐ฒ๐ ๐ฎ๐ป๐ฑ ๐ฆ๐ฝ๐ฒ๐ฐ๐ถ๐ณ๐ถ๐ฐ๐ฎ๐๐ถ๐ผ๐ป๐
BMS Integration for HVAC systems includes a variety of features designed to improve efficiency and control. These systems provide real-time monitoring, data analytics, and automated control processes. The specifications can vary depending on the specific integration and manufacturer.
Key specifications include:
1. Control Interfaces
- User-friendly interfaces for easy operation
- Compatibility with mobile devices and computer systems
2. Data Logging
- Continuous logging of temperature, humidity, and energy usage
- Exportable data for analysis and reporting
3. Communication Protocols
- Support for standard protocols like BACnet, Modbus, and LonWorks
- Ensures interoperability with various HVAC components
4. Energy Management Features
- Real-time energy consumption tracking
- Alerts for unusual energy usage patterns
5. Remote Access Capabilities
- Ability to monitor and control HVAC systems from remote locations
- Enhanced flexibility and responsiveness
6. Alarm and Notification System
- Automatic alerts for system malfunctions or anomalies
- Customizable notification settings
7. Integration with Other Systems
- Ability to integrate with security, lighting, and fire safety systems
- Comprehensive building management solutions
8. Reporting and Analytics
- Built-in reporting tools for performance analysis
- Visualization of data trends over time
In summary, BMS Integration for HVAC offers critical features that enhance operational efficiency, facilitate real-time monitoring, and promote energy savings.
๐๐ผ๐บ๐บ๐ผ๐ป ๐๐ฝ๐ฝ๐น๐ถ๐ฐ๐ฎ๐๐ถ๐ผ๐ป๐ ๐ฎ๐ป๐ฑ ๐จ๐๐ฒ ๐๐ฎ๐๐ฒ๐
BMS Integration for HVAC serves various industries, providing tailored solutions that meet specific operational needs.
1. Commercial Real Estate: In office buildings, BMS Integration helps maintain optimal temperature and air quality for tenant comfort while reducing energy costs.
2. Manufacturing: Factories utilize BMS Integration to control climate conditions that are critical for product quality and employee safety.
3. Healthcare: Hospitals rely on integrated HVAC systems to ensure sterile environments and maintain regulatory compliance for air quality.
4. Retail: Stores benefit from BMS Integration by creating a comfortable shopping experience, while also managing energy consumption during off-peak hours.
5. Education: Schools and universities use these systems to provide a conducive learning environment, balancing energy efficiency with comfort.
6. Hospitality: Hotels implement BMS Integration to enhance guest satisfaction by providing personalized climate control in rooms.
7. Data Centers: These facilities require precise temperature and humidity control, making BMS Integration essential for equipment performance and reliability.
